Output 24b531f87ffdadb5c3d1bd205de6cec81e25dc98326792655c021402ca1f1d54:21

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a6ef3ee104b2352604fcdbec1fa0e5be77b7c8 OP_EQUAL
address
3MMHBbx4dZoaKckTyV7tRriqyhc4P5QERu
transaction
24b531f87ffdadb5c3d1bd205de6cec81e25dc98326792655c021402ca1f1d54
spent
true